How do trees grow after cutting
If trees are cut down its roots are left in the ground, and it is possible for new shoots to sprout off the root structure. This process is referred to as coppicing and is a survival strategy that is employed by a few species of tree. Coppicing enables trees to regrow after being cut down or damaged as well as providing a source of new growth in the forest.
Factors That Affect Tree Regrowth
The ability of a tree’s roots to regenerate after being cut down is dependent on many aspects, including the tree species and the size of the tree, and the condition of its root system. Certain tree species like willows or birches are more likely regrow after being cut and others, such as oak trees are less likely to do so. The size of the tree and the health of the root system have a major impact on determining whether a tree will regrow.
Tree Species
Trees that are renowned for their ability to re-grow after being cut includes willows and birches, and poplars. They have a rapid-growing root system, and are able to sprout new shoots rapidly. On the other hand oak trees and other species that slow grow are less likely to regrow after being cut.
Tree Size
The bigger the tree, the more difficult it will be for it to regrow after being cut down. This is due to the fact that the tree’s root system gets larger when the tree expands, making it difficult for new shoots to sprout.
Root System Health
The health of a tree’s root systems is another crucial factor in determining whether it will regrow after it has been cut. When the roots are damaged, or infected it might be difficult for the tree to re-grow.
